1. Persistent Clogs Are Driving You Crazy

Understanding the Nature of Clogs

Clogged drains are one of the most common household plumbing issues. While occasional clogs can be easily remedied with store-bought drain cleaners or plungers, persistent clogs signal deeper issues within your plumbing system.

Why Clogs Occur

Clogs may occur due to:

    Hair buildup Grease accumulation Foreign objects lodged in pipes Tree roots infiltrating sewer lines

2. Unpleasant Odors Lurking Around Your Home

Identifying Unpleasant Smells

Have you noticed foul odors coming from your sinks or drains? This unpleasant scent could be a sign of stagnant water or decaying organic matter trapped inside your plumbing system.

Where Do These Smells Come From?

Common sources of these odors include:

    Bacteria buildup Dry P-traps Sewer line leaks

These smells not only indicate potential plumbing issues but also pose health risks. It’s crucial not to ignore these warning signs.

4. Fluctuating Water Pressure Is Becoming an Annoyance

Understanding Water Pressure Issues

Are you experiencing inconsistent water pressure? Whether it’s high pressure causing splashes or low pressure leaving you waiting for water flow, fluctuating water pressure is often symptomatic of an underlying issue.

Causes of Water Pressure Problems

Several factors could cause these fluctuations:

    Pipe corrosion Blockages within pipes Municipal supply issues

Low water pressure may also indicate a leak somewhere within your system—something that needs immediate attention.

Can I prevent drain clogs?

Yes! Regular maintenance such as avoiding pouring grease down sinks and using hair catchers can significantly reduce clog occurrences.
